Output 57523ab401b6bad3bb4e43fede98ecd540fae57abcad13dfd7370c7ee779a78c:3

value
189106
script pubkey
OP_0 OP_PUSHBYTES_20 e6fb4db5fc32795924c590d66a4059b9f4beee1b
address
bc1quma5md0uxfu4jfx9jrtx5szeh86tamsmf29jld
transaction
57523ab401b6bad3bb4e43fede98ecd540fae57abcad13dfd7370c7ee779a78c
confirmations
45860
spent
true